This bagel shop was named the best in Alabama


The Daily Meal has named Crestline Bagel the best bagel shop in Alabama. In November, the food and beverage website published a list of the best spots to get the breakfast staple in each state. Using a mashup of reviews and news stories to find the best shops, The Daily Meal compiled a list of hidden gems, iconic institutions, and local legends to reveal the “crème de la crème of bagel shops in every state.”

Here’s what The Daily Meal had to say about Crestline Bagel:

“Crestline Bagel Co. is a 20-year business that has the taste and the reviews to earn the top spot in the state of Alabama. Offering a delightful array of freshly baked bagels, ranging from classic favorites to inventive flavors, savory to sweet, it caters to every palate. 

One of Crestline Bagel’s signatures is its New York style bagels, which are not always easy to come by down South. According to a Yelp review, one native New Yorker said Crestline has “the best bagel I have had in Alabama.”

Crestline Bagel Company has locations in Mountain Brook’s Crestline Village, Cahaba Heights, and downtown Birmingham inside Innovation Depot.

Named a “Birmingham Staple” by Bham Now, Crestline Bagel is known for its bagel and cream cheese combinations and bagel sandwiches. The breakfast and lunch spot also offers doughnuts, scones, and cookies.

Alabama hires former college offensive lineman as assistant tight ends coach




Alabama football is hiring Noah Fisher to be its assistant tight ends coach, according to CBS Sports’ Matt Zenitz.

Fisher spent two seasons as a graduate assistant working with the offensive line and tight ends at Louisville before joining the Tide’s staff. He played three years on the offensive line at South Alabama and spent one season with Tulane. The Jaguars started Fisher along its offensive line when he was a player for multiple games.

The Crimson Tide appear to want to use their tight ends in multiple ways in the future including as extra blockers along the line of scrimmage. Fisher looks as if he can assist the Tide with this mission.

Petition calls on State of Alabama to fund fix for Prichard sewer system after spills


Sewage overflows during storms in Prichard are sending wastewater into local waterways that feed Mobile Bay, prompting an environmental group to push for state funding to upgrade aging infrastructure.

Mobile Baykeeper says sewage overflows during storms flow into Three Mile Creek, then into the Mobile River, and ultimately end up in Mobile Bay. The group said that last week, during heavy rain, more than 256,000 gallons of sewage spilled into Gum Tree Branch and Three Mile Creek.

Mobile Baykeeper has launched a petition seeking funding from the state of Alabama to fix Prichard’s old water infrastructure.
